[-help]DDEESSCCRRIIPPTTIIOONN The home directory of _b_b_o_a_r_d_s is where the BBoard system is kept. This documentation describes some of the nuances of the BBoard system. Note that if your system is configured to use the Network News Transfer Protocol (NNNNTTPP) to read BBoards, (your sys- tem does seem to be configured this way), then there is no local bboards setup; instead, _b_b_c opens an NNNNTTPP connection to the local server. BBBBooaarrddss,, BBBBooaarrdd--IIDDss A BBoard is just a file containing a group of mes- sages relating to the same topic. These files live in the ~bboards home directory. Each message in a BBoard file has in its header the line "BBoard-Id: n", where "n" is an ascending decimal number. This id-number is unique for each message in a BBoards file. It should NOT be confused with the message number of a message, which can change as messages are removed from the BBoard. BBBBooaarrdd HHaannddlliinngg To read BBoards, use the _b_b_c and _m_s_h programs. The _m_s_h command is a monolithic program which contains all the functionality of _M_H in a single program. The `-check' switch to _b_b_c lets you check on the status of BBoards, and the `-read' switch tells _b_b_c to invoke _m_s_h to read those BBoards. CCrreeaattiinngg aa BBBBooaarrdd Both public, and private BBoards are supported. Con- tact the mail address _P_o_s_t_M_a_s_t_e_r if you'd like to have a BBoard created.
